Oficina prática de introdução a Go

Data: Em breve

Horário: A definir

Carga horária: 2h30min

Valor do investimento: Gratuito

Instrutor: Luciano Ramalho

 

Palestra – Oficina prática de introdução a Go – Centro de Treinamento da Novatec

Sobre a atividade

Após uma rápida apresentação sobre a importância da linguagem Go, 90% do tempo será dedicado a uma atividade mão-na-massa: criar um programa simples porém completo para pesquisar caracteres Unicode pelo nome: bom para encontrar desde símbolos matemáticos até emojis de gatinhos. Toda a parte prática será guiada por testes automatizados, conforme a metodologia TDD (Test-Driven Design, projeto guiado por testes).

Objetivo

Apresentar conceitos fundamentais da linguagem Go, bem como técnicas básicas para testes automatizados.

A quem se destina o curso

Pessoas que já sabem programar e querem ter um contato prático com Go.

Conteúdo da palestra

0 – Palestra: porque aprender Go
1 – Iniciando o TDD
2 – Primeira função completa com testes
3 – Gerar a lista de caracteres
4 – MVP 1, o mínimo que é útil
5 – Busca por palavras inteiras
6 – Exercício: hífens e nomes antigos
7 – Bônus: download automático da UCD

Facilitador

 Luciano Ramalho, autor do livro Python Fluente e consultor técnico principal na ThoughtWorks

Instrutor

Luciano Ramalho

Luciano Ramalho é programador Python desde 1998, Fellow da Python Software Foundation; é sócio do Python.pro.br – uma empresa de treinamento – e cofundador do Garoa Hacker Clube, o primeiro hackerspace do Brasil. Tem liderado equipes de desenvolvimento de software e ministrado cursos sobre Python em empresas de mídia, bancos e para o governo federal.


Avise-me quando este curso estiver disponível

Nome

Email

Telefone

Nome do curso

Período
 Diurno Manhã Tarde Noite Sábado Domingo

CompartilheShare on TumblrShare on LinkedInTweet about this on TwitterPin on PinterestShare on Google+Share on FacebookEmail this to someone